- Hawangen, GermanyDouble membrane gas storage
Year of construction 2010 / refurbishment 2023 - 3 storage tanks
The biogas plant built in 2010, which is fed with renewable raw materials, was upgraded and refurbished in 2023. The existing gas storage tanks were converted to a usable gas storage volume of approx. 2,700 m³.
The double-membrane gas storage tanks were also equipped with a belt tensioning system, service opening and pressure gauge. The existing substructure could continue to be used.
- Dombühl, GermanyDouble membrane gas storage
Refurbishment and expansion of the Nawaro biogas plant in 2020 from EPDM to double membrane gas storage with a usable total volume of approx. 2500 kW.
4 x hemispheres with upstands between 1.0m and 2.0m
The double membrane gas storage tanks were converted to a double flat profile and equipped with additional service openings, new measurement technology, pressure sensors and overpressure protection. The existing substructure could continue to be used for all four tanks.
- Weihenzell, GermanyDouble membrane gas storage
In 2022, the storage power plant in Weihenzell was extensively renovated and expanded with a view to the future. As part of this, the existing tanks were converted from single-shell covers to double membrane gas storage tanks with half domes. The new gas storage solution was installed with a stainless steel U-profile fastening, while the substructure was retained in its entirety.
In addition, two new tanks with a usable volume of over 7,000 m³ were constructed, one with a special height and the other with a half dome.
Today, the Nawaro plant has an output of approx. 3,700 kW.
- Obing, GermanyDouble membrane gas storage
The Seimlhof environmental station operates a 75 kW biogas plant that supplies both electricity and heat for the connected educational farm's own needs. The plant was built in 2019 and consists of a tank with a dome-shaped double membrane gas storage tank. It is supplemented by modern measurement technology and a pressure safety device to ensure safe and efficient operation.
